710whp Project 9s Scion FRS - Tuned by Delicious Tuning
 
We made a trip to San Antonio, Texas last weekend and tuned the Project 9's Scion FRS. With a bit of work and a hot 101 degree day we were able to extract 710whp of the the car on 30 PSI using EcuTeK ProECU.

Yes this is still an FA20 engine, but a built closed deck block by Outfront Motorsports, our go to engine builder. The vehicle has a custom Spencer Fabrication Twin Scroll Turbo Kit, DW 1500cc Injectors, and our Delicious Tuning Flex Fuel Kit and our customized Flash & Go Tune.
